Tony HutchingsTony Hutchings
Always wanted to try this restaurant and finally got around to doing it as a party of 4. It was a Monday evening, so it was a little empty, but this worked to our advantage as the staff were very attentive and helped us decide what to have. The vegetable sharring starter was excellent. Three of us had the chicken with Blackbean sauce. It was very tasty, although two guests didn't expect it to have chillies in. I would recommend checking if you're going for this dish, thinking it wouldn't be spicy. Personally, I thought it was just right. Another had the duck starter and liked it. The banana fritters were excellent.
Russel HowesRussel Howes
Nice atmosphere and a good looking cosy restaurant. Service good. We had satay chicken and dumplings to start with which were good. The main course was Pad Ki Mao (pad thai) which was fantastic, green chicken curry and beef jungle curry. Plus coconut rice. All was very good except the jungle curry which seemed to be lacking flavour. I’m not sure if it was the dish choice but it seemed very bland. Otherwise I would recommend this restaurant if you are in the mood for Thai food.

Absolutely disappointed ☹️ with our meal tonight. After a hard day's work in the garden we thought we'd go out for a meal rather than cook. We were ravenous on arrival and were disappointed with the long wait to order seeing as it was a Monday. We chose tempura prawns (and did ask the waitress if they'd be enough to share for a starter which she said yes it would be plenty) followed by noodle dishes with a special request of no onions or garlic in the main for my husband. Again a rather long wait with only four tables in the restaurant the tempura prawns arrived. They resembled 4 matchsticks on the plate with a tad of side salad, which we thought rather stingy for £8. After more waiting the mains arrived. At a first glance all looked quite nice until my husband saw red onion on the side salad thennnn spring onion sprinkled on his noodles. Instantly we told the waitress and we were told by a member of the kitchen staff that they'd make a fresh dish. The new dish arrived within 3 minutes. Feeling even more ravenous we began eating but then half way through my husband starting to find spring onion. Asked if our food was okay we said NO because they hadn't made us a fresh dish but instead picked off the spring onion. The lady from the kitchen did apologize and said would we like some discount to which we replied we wouldn't like to pay for his meal. She went to ask the manager but came back with a 10% offer. So overall customer service was shocking because the manager couldn't even come out to discuss but hid in the kitchen. Also when coming online to find reviews for the restaurant we learn that the tempura prawns are most likely bought from Iceland. I looked them up and yes same ones, ten in a box for £2. Absolutely won't be going in there again as nothing authentic about...

Visited Thailand Tom in Hythe for our anniversary dinner and unfortunately, it didn’t live up to expectations.

We arrived around 7pm on a quiet Thursday night. The restaurant wasn’t busy, but the greeting was cold and unwelcoming. The woman at the bar seemed annoyed we were there and only reluctantly seated us. Thankfully, another staff member later came over who was friendly and took our drinks order.

We had seen a sign outside advertising cocktails, but were told the person who makes them wasn’t in. It’s confusing to advertise cocktails if they aren’t reliably available.

Food was mixed: prawn crackers were nice, the sweet chilli sauce was decent (likely bottled), but the peanut sauce had no flavour. Duck spring rolls were hot and crispy but lacked much duck. My sizzling prawns were a highlight—they came out properly sizzling and tasted fine. The plain noodles were exactly that—dry and obviously from a packet. My wife’s rice was actually cold, and her pork dish was barely warm. They brought hot rice when we complained, but it shouldn't have happened in the first place. The pork was also quite tough.

After finishing, we were left sitting for a while and felt forgotten. When I went to pay, I mentioned the cold rice and suggested they remove the charge. They refused, insisting we ate it—even though we only ate the second portion they brought. That was disappointing.

Overall, it felt like we were more of an inconvenience than guests. A couple of positives, but not enough to...
